The 2026 Canadian Masters Road Championships are set to occur in Calgary, Alberta, on Saturday, bringing together cyclists from various regions of Canada. Participants will compete not only for medals but also for the prestigious maple leaf jerseys, which signify excellence in the sport. This event is part of a broader initiative to promote amateur cycling across the nation and to encourage participation in competitive cycling events.
Calgary has a history of hosting cycling events and is well-equipped to provide the necessary infrastructure and support for participants and attendees alike. The championships will offer a platform for masters cyclists to showcase their skills and dedication to the sport. As cycling continues to grow in popularity in Canada, such events serve to foster community engagement and promote health and fitness among Canadians of all ages.
Local cycling clubs and organizations have expressed enthusiasm for the championships, citing it as an opportunity to encourage new cyclists and support local tourism. The event is expected to draw competitors from all over Canada, further solidifying Calgary's reputation as a vibrant cycling community.
